Use the explicit formula an = a1 + (n - 1) • d to find the 350th term of the sequence below. 57, 66, 75, 84, 93, ... A. 3234 B.
mylen [45]
To use the equation we need a1 and d(the common difference).
We have a1 = 57, we need to find d.
93-84 = 9; 84-75=9; 75-66=9; 66-57=9
d = 9
a350 = 57 + (350-1)(9)
a350 = 57 + (349)(9)
a350 = 57 + 3141
a350 = 3198

Find the cost of painting a cubical block of side length 3.2 cm, if painting costs $5 per cm2.
SashulF [63]
<h3><u>Answer</u>:- </h3>

\longrightarrow \sf \$ \: 307.2

<h3><u>Solution:-</u></h3>

Since painting is done on outer surface of cubical block we will have to find its surface area which is given by-

\green{ \underline { \boxed{ \sf{Surface \: area  \:of  \:Cube = 6a^2}}}}

  • <u>where a is side of the cube </u>

\begin{gathered}\\\quad \sf Surface \: area  \:of  \:Cube = 6\times(3.2)^2  \\\end{gathered}

\begin{gathered}\\\implies \quad \sf  6\times 3.2\times3.2   \\\end{gathered}

\begin{gathered}\\\implies \quad \sf  61.44 cm^2  \\\end{gathered}

Now,

\maltese \sf Cost  \:of  \:painting \: 1 \: cm² = \$ 5

\sf Cost \: of \: painting \: 61.44  \:cm²=61.44×5

\sf\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ad\quad=\$ 307.2

\leadstoThus it would cost $ 307.2 to paint the entire cubical block.
